About this property

Newmarket Inn

Located near a train station, Newmarket Inn is a great choice for a stay in East Gwillimbury. Guests can enjoy the indoor pool, and hiking/biking trails, mountain biking, and cross-country skiing are nearby. A terrace and a garden are offered, and in-room conveniences include refrigerators and microwaves.

Policies

This property has outdoor spaces, such as balconies, patios, terraces which may not be suitable for children. If you have concerns, we recommend contacting the property prior to your arrival to confirm they can accommodate you in a suitable room.
This property's policy is to refuse certain bookings for the purpose of group events or parties, including pre-wedding stag/bachelor and hen/bachelorette parties.
Only registered guests are allowed in the guestrooms.
This property does not have elevators.
Guests can rest easy knowing there's a carbon monoxide detector, a fire extinguisher, a smoke detector, a security system, a first aid kit, and window guards on site.
The name on the credit card used at check-in to pay for incidentals must be the primary name on the guestroom reservation.
This property accepts credit cards. Cash is not accepted.
Credit cards accepted: Visa, Mastercard, American Express
